E84: OLD
E34 Inscription
Subclass of: E33 Linguistic Object E37 Mark Scope note: This
class comprises recognisable, short texts attached to instances of E24 Physical
Man-Made Thing. The transcription of the text can be documented in a note by
P3 has note: E62 String. The alphabet used can be documented by P2 has type:
E55 Type. This class does not intend to describe the idiosyncratic
characteristics of an individual physical embodiment of an inscription, but the
underlying prototype. The physical embodiment is modelled in the CRM as E24
Physical Man-Made Thing. The relationship of a physical copy of a book to the
text it contains is modelled using E84 Information Carrier. P128 carries (is
carried by): E33 Linguistic Object. Examples: § “keep off the
grass” on a sign stuck in the lawn of the quad of Balliol College § The text
published in Corpus Inscriptionum Latinarum V 895 § Kilroy was here In
First Order Logic: E34(x) ⊃ E33(x)
